Why is BuzzFeed popular?

BuzzFeed was set up eight years ago as a research lab for creating viral content, and has grown into one of the world's most popular news and entertainment websites with a monthly audience of 130 million unique visitors and an expanding roster of brands signed up to its native advertising offer.

What is BuzzFeed quiz party?

BuzzFeed has introduced a multiplayer version of its classic quizzes called Quiz Party, which lets you and up to three friends complete them simultaneously in your browser. You're each still essentially completing the quiz on your own, and there's no chat feature to let you talk to your friends.

What is a Subbuzz on BuzzFeed?

This is called a "subbuzz." It's where you'll enter all content for your post, like images and text, and where you'll find our Quiz Maker: BuzzFeed / Via BuzzFeed. To add a new text box or image, you'll need to create a new subbuzz each time.

Why did the try guys quit BuzzFeed?

On December 2, 2019, the Try Guys explained that they decided to leave Buzzfeed as their contracts' expiring, with Zach and Ned contributing to the idea of developing their own independent production company while discussing the future of The Try Guys.
